Skip to content

Commit

Permalink
[AArch64] Add some release notes items (#79983)
Browse files Browse the repository at this point in the history
  • Loading branch information
momchil-velikov committed Feb 7, 2024
1 parent d5e2f0e commit a9a790e
Show file tree
Hide file tree
Showing 2 changed files with 13 additions and 0 deletions.
5 changes: 5 additions & 0 deletions clang/docs/ReleaseNotes.rst
Original file line number Diff line number Diff line change
Expand Up @@ -1167,6 +1167,11 @@ Arm and AArch64 Support
* Cortex-A720 (cortex-a720).
* Cortex-X4 (cortex-x4).

- Alpha support has been added for SVE2.1 intrinsics.

- Support has been added for `-fstack-clash-protection` and `-mstack-probe-size`
command line options.

- Function Multi Versioning has been extended to support Load-Acquire RCpc
instructions v3 (rcpc3) as well as Memory Copy and Memory Set Acceleration
instructions (mops) when targeting AArch64. The feature identifiers (in
Expand Down
8 changes: 8 additions & 0 deletions llvm/docs/ReleaseNotes.rst
Original file line number Diff line number Diff line change
Expand Up @@ -105,6 +105,14 @@ Changes to the AArch64 Backend
Armv9.0a has the same features enabled as Armv8.5a, with the exception
of crypto.

* Assembler/disassembler support has been added for 2023 architecture
extensions.

* Support has been added for Stack Clash Protection. During function frame
creation and dynamic stack allocations, the compiler will issue memory
accesses at reguilar intervals so that a guard area at the top of the stack
can't be skipped over.

Changes to the AMDGPU Backend
-----------------------------

Expand Down

0 comments on commit a9a790e

Please sign in to comment.